Cherokee Succotash

ingredients
2 pounds fresh or dry lima beans (small ones are best)
3 cups fresh corn cut from cob
5 wild onions (pearl onions may be substituted)
salt, to taste
black pepper, to taste
2 tablespoons melted bacon fat
2 pieces smoked ham hock
3 quarts water
directions
Soak beans, if using dry ones, for 3-4 hours.
Bring the water to a boil then add the beans. Cook at a moderate boil for 10 minutes then add the corn, ham hocks, salt and pepper, and onions.
Reduce heat and cook for 1 hour on a low heat.
